Bandar Tun Razak Advertising

Purchasing Power

Purchasing power is moderate and stable, supported by residents, hospital users, students, government workers and sports facility visitors. Spending focuses on food, groceries, clinics, transport, education and daily retail.

Ethnicity/Race

The area has a mixed Kuala Lumpur demographic with Malay, Chinese, Indian and other communities. It includes long-time residents, public-sector users, students, hospital visitors and families.

Prominent Roads

Prominent roads include Jalan Yaacob Latif, East-West Link Expressway, Cheras routes, Kuala Lumpur-Seremban access, Jalan Loke Yew connections and roads toward Bandar Tasik Selatan.

Local Businesses(Retails/Factories

Local businesses include food courts, restaurants, clinics, mini markets, petrol stations, pharmacies, convenience stores, photo shops, banks and services around hospitals, parks and residential areas.

Cost of living

Cost of living is moderate for Kuala Lumpur. Older residential areas and flats can be relatively affordable, while newer nearby developments around Bandar Sri Permaisuri and Cheras may cost more.

Landmarks

Landmarks include Permaisuri Lake Gardens, Kuala Lumpur Football Stadium, Bandar Tun Razak LRT Station, HUKM/UKM Medical Centre nearby, DBKL facilities, sports centre and public swimming pool.

Highlights & Attractions

Highlights include Permaisuri Lake Gardens, sports facilities, LRT access, hospital proximity, mature residential communities and practical connectivity to Cheras and southern Kuala Lumpur.

Population data

Population depends on the boundary used, but the area serves a large southeastern Kuala Lumpur catchment including Cheras, Bandar Sri Permaisuri, Taman Midah and Bandar Tasik Selatan.

Traffic Flow & Movement

Traffic is moderate to heavy during peak hours, especially near Cheras routes, East-West Link, Sungai Besi access, schools, HUKM and Permaisuri Lake Gardens. Event days around sports facilities can increase congestion.

Market Profile

Business opportunities fit neighbourhood retail, F&B, clinics, sports services, education, convenience stores, pharmacies and services linked to hospitals, schools and community facilities.
